![]() Hi Lisa, Don't run 2 firewalls together - they'll conflict with each other & won't work properly. If you're sure that you have a Norton firewall (Norton Anti Virus doesn't include a firewall) then turn off the Windows firewall & just configure the Norton to allow LW: PortForward.com - Free Help Setting up Your Router or Firewall You could also try removing any current LW rules from the Norton firewall & then setting new rules: http://www.gnutellaforums.com/226610-post6.html If LW's just started acting up after you installed Pro, delete LW's preferences folder when LW's properly closed. This thread has info about that (& a link for Vista users), plus heaps of other connection fixes to try: If LW Will Not Connect If deleting the prefs folder doesn't work, next thing to try would be deleting/replacing the gnutella.net file ![]() If nothing helps & you're sure that you've done everything correctly, maybe there's a problem with your router. Have a look at all the boxes that connect to your computer. Your router (or modem/router) is the box that lets you connect to the net. It's got lots of little lights on it. Have a look for brand & model (if nothing's showing then have a look underneath). If you have a wireless connection then the router might be in another room. |
